Shipping

The Smithsonian Institution is a large organization with multiple business entities (departments) offering a broad variety of products and services for sale. Depending on the items selected, you may receive multiple shipments.

We calculate shipping costs twice to ensure you receive the "best available" shipping rate. First we calculate the per item shipping cost for your entire order. Second, we calculate the cost of all items ordered and calculate a shipping rate based on a standard shipping table. Your "actual" shipping costs will be the lesser of these two amounts.

Shipping charges for the entire order are billed once the first item ships by the participating department(s).
